i3 20" wheels, forged or cast?

Does anyone out there know if the i3 20" OEM wheels are forged or cast? Reason being is that I plan to powder coat my wheels, but heard that it's not smart to powder coat forged wheels. Thoughts anyone? Thanks in advance!

Forged usually cost a lot more and they make a big deal of it in the specifications (as they tend to be lighter and stronger). In this case, lighter would be nice.

Where did you see that they were forged? The vast majority of them are cast out there.
